What is the difference between Valuation Associate vs Financial Analyst?
| Aspect | Valuation Associate | Financial Analyst |
|---|---|---|
| Required Credentials | Bachelor's degree in finance, accounting, or related field; certifications like CFA or ASA are a plus | Bachelor's degree in finance, economics, or related field; CFA preferred |
| Work Environment | Typically in valuation firms, consulting, or investment banks; focus on valuation projects | Corporate finance departments, investment firms, or banks; broader financial analysis tasks |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Used in valuation, M&A, and investment banking sectors | Common across finance, corporate, and investment sectors |
| Comparison Search Intent | Valuation Associate vs Financial Analyst |
Both roles require strong financial analysis skills and relevant certifications. Valuation Associates focus specifically on valuation projects, often in M&A or investment banking, while Financial Analysts have a broader scope, including budgeting, forecasting, and financial reporting. The roles overlap in skills but differ in scope and industry focus.

About our Financial Advisory Services (FAS) TeamThe EisnerAmper Financial Advisory Services team is comprised of a diverse group of professionals from across the country with a multitude of experience and certifications to leverage distinctive perspectives and specializations. We're equipped to meet all our clients' unique challenges including reorganizations, Ponzi schemes, fraud, contractual disputes, matrimonial claims, Intellectual Property disputes, valuation, and forensic investigations.
Divided into five main arms of Bankruptcy & Restructuring, Forensic Accounting, Transactional Advisory Services, Corporate Finance and Valuation Services, our client base is comprised primarily of lawyers and law firms of all sizes."
